Certificate in Battery Storage Technologies for Renewable Energy holds immense significance in today's market, particularly in the UK. The UK government aims to reach net-zero carbon emissions by 2050, and battery storage technologies play a crucial role in achieving this goal. According to the UK's Department for Business, Energy & Industrial Strategy, the UK's energy storage market is expected to grow from £1.4 billion in 2020 to £13.4 billion by 2030.

Year Market Size (£ billion)
2020 1.4
2025 6.3
2030 13.4
